Through the story of Nicodemus, this sermon explores the radical act of being born again by the Spirit--an act so hard that it is most appealing to those who are lost, an act so infused by God's grace that it may just be possible for us all. The sermon calls listeners to examine their lives for the places in need of God's transformation and rebirth. (Abstract created by Duke Divinity School staff.)
